4 Flagship Home A 19 th century house and 21 st century energy efficiency technologies combine to deliver reduced carbon emissions, lower fuel bills and affordable housing in the heart of London

5 Aim Refurbish an existing HMO to high standards of energy efficiency Provide affordable accommodation Demonstrate the project to other landlords

6 The Project Typical Victorian terrace property in Knightsbridge Conservation area but not listed

7 The project In poor state of repair

8 The Project Failed to meet RBKCs current Fitness Standards

9 The Project Applied for EST Innovation Funding Feasibility study Discussions agreement with landlord

10 Feasibility Study Aim –To show private landlords it is possible to refurbish a building in a practical, cost effective way which reduces energy consumption and could save money in the long term.

11 Feasibility study - scenarios Minimum measures and costs to meet Standards Incorporating energy efficiency measures and additional costs Cost effectiveness

12 Feasibility study – cost effectiveness New roof extension Self contained basement flat Funding (EEC, local authority) Solar hot water heating

13 Technology - measures Measures were chosen that would benefit landlords most in terms of saving money and being easy to maintain Package of measures that took an integrated approach to: –Reduced heat losses; –Provide efficient, controllable heating;

14 Technology – fabric measures Insulated dry lining Roof insulation Glazing Basement floor

15 Technology – fabric measures –Heating and hot water –Mechanical ventilation with heat recovery –Lights and appliances

16 Outcomes Refurbishment will significantly reduce energy consumption and CO2 emissions eg: –Energy costs expected to fall by 67% –CO2 emissions expected to be cut by 63% –NHER increase from 3.0 to 9.0

17 Affordable Housing HMO contains 19 bedsits Accommodation for 36 tenants Four units let to key workers on affordable rents
